**Q: Why does the TileForge cache layer evict entries before TTL expiry?**

A: Eviction in TileForge is pressure-based, not strictly TTL-based. When the shard's memory budget exceeds 85%, the least-recently-rendered tiles are dropped regardless of remaining TTL. Reviewers should verify that eviction callbacks release the render buffer before the entry is removed. If eviction behavior still looks wrong after checking the budget config, reach out to the cache maintainers.

billing contact of hahig-yajop = fraael_fraox@nelvrocorp.internal

Welcome to on-call for Fablekit, our test-data factory library used across the Quillhaven services. Fablekit seeds deterministic fixtures; most pages involve sequence collisions after parallel suite runs. Before touching the seed registry, read the trait-override rules carefully — they cascade. The full triage checklist and escalation path are kept on this internal page.

runbook for badug-kadup: https://confluence.zemvarlabs.internal/projects/browse/display/projects/bd1b

Build provenance: SeatScape renderer (Marquee Theatres). The seat-map renderer ships as a versioned bundle whose provenance is recorded at publish time, linking source revision, builder identity, and test attestation. On-call engineers diagnosing rendering regressions in venue layouts should never patch bundles in place; instead, verify the deployed bundle against its provenance record, then roll back to the last attested version if the hashes disagree. The provenance record for the current production bundle carries the token shown below.

session token of kafop-hawep = htk21_413e49a27bdeacde54774